Web22 Nov 2024 · Piriformis Trigger Points Piriformis trigger points are very common and relatively easy to locate. These sensitive points are capable of referring pain down the backside of the leg. Due to this phenomenon, trigger point activity may be mistaken for symptoms of sciatica.

The sciatic nerve runs from the nerves at the base of the … WebKey Points Sciatica is pain along the sciatic nerve. It usually results from compression of lumbar nerve roots in the lower back. Common causes include intervertebral disk herniation, osteophytes, and narrowing of the spinal canal (spinal stenosis). Symptoms include pain radiating from the buttocks down the leg.

Web11 Feb 2024 · Overview. Myofascial pain syndrome is a chronic pain disorder. In this condition, pressure on sensitive points in your muscles (trigger points) causes pain in the muscle and sometimes in seemingly unrelated parts of your body. This is called referred pain. This syndrome typically occurs after a muscle has been contracted repetitively.
